Eligibility Criteria

Aspirants seeking admission to 4 year Full-time B.Tech Program should meet the following criteria as specified by the institute.

Academic Requirement: 

Candidate must have passed 10+2 with relevant stream from a recognized board or its equivalent.

Entrance Exam:

Candidate should be selected through EAMCET entrance exam.
